#a573fb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a573fb is composed of 64.7% red, 45.1% green and 98.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 34.3% cyan, 54.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 1.6% black. It has a hue angle of 262.1 degrees, a saturation of 94.4% and a lightness of 71.8%. #a573fb color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e6ff with #4b00f7. Closest websafe color is: #9966ff.

#a573fb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a573fb has RGB values of R:165, G:115, B:251 and CMYK values of C:0.34, M:0.54, Y:0,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 10843131.

Shades and Tints of #a573fb
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#05000d is the darkest color, while #fbf8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#a573fb
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b7b5b9 is the less saturated color, while #a573fb is the most saturated one.
